Kibra MP Peter Orero’s Driver Fined Sh100,000 for Ngong Road Obstruction

By Michelle Ndaga

The Director of Public Prosecutions (DPP) has charged a Nairobi driver whose reckless overtaking was captured in a viral video circulating on social media.

The driver, identified as George Oduor, appeared before the Milimani Law Courts, where he was charged with dangerous overtaking contrary to Rule 73(4) as read with Rule 99 of the Traffic Rules under CAP 403, Laws of Kenya. Prosecuting Counsel Ismael Keragu told the court that the accused had dangerously overtaken a stream of vehicles along Oloitoktok Roadwithin Nairobi County on 9th of October 2025, at around 2:40 PM.

Following the circulation of the video, originally shared on social media by journalist Larry Madowo, police officers from Kilimani Police Stationlaunched investigations to establish the circumstances surrounding the incident. Detectives visited the scene and managed to retrieve CCTV footage from a nearby building, which corroborated the viral clip.

Further investigations led police to the registered owner of the vehicle, who disclosed that his personal driver was behind the wheel at the time of the incident. The driver was subsequently summoned and arrested. Appearing before Principal Magistrate Rose Ndobi, Oduor pleaded guiltyto the charges.

Upon conviction, the court sentenced him to pay a fine of Ksh 100,000 or, in default, serve five months in imprisonment.
